What Happened

Nissan Formula E Team has unveiled The NISMO Pit, a pop-up fan experience for the Tokyo E-Prix on Saturday, July 25. Inspired by Japan's 90s car scene where enthusiasts gathered to celebrate community and craftsmanship, the event aims to revive that ritual. Visitors can see iconic Nissan performance vehicles from the Heritage Collection, enjoy diner-inspired food, and listen to live DJ sets.

The event is created in collaboration with Tokyo-based car network NowhereToGo, showcasing modified Nissan road cars that highlight creativity and individuality. Additionally, the current Nissan Formula E GEN3 Evo car will be displayed with a special one-off NISMO-inspired livery, featuring grey, black, red accents, and the team's cherry blossom motif.

Event Schedule
  1. July 25, 18:00 (UTC+9)

    The NISMO Pit opens at City Circuit Tokyo Bay

  2. July 25, 20:00

    Round 14 of the Tokyo E-Prix begins, shown on screens

  3. July 25, 23:00

    Experience closes

Highlights at The NISMO Pit
  • Iconic Nissan performance vehicles from the Heritage Collection
  • Classic diner-inspired food and live DJ sets
  • Modified Nissan road cars from NowhereToGo network
  • GEN3 Evo car with special one-off NISMO-inspired livery
  • Artwork by Kenichi Minami transforming the space

Terms in This Story

E-Prix
A street race in the Formula E championship, similar to a Grand Prix.
GEN3 Evo
The third-generation Formula E car with enhancements, used from Season 11 onward.
NISMO
Nissan's motorsport and performance division, known for tuning and race-inspired road cars.
Livery
A vehicle's paint scheme and decals, often featuring team colors and sponsors.
